Important-Satisfaction Analysis as a Management Strategy of the Seoul Castle Path - Mainly with Bukak Mountain Path -
서주환 Suh Joo-hwan , 임교아 Lim Kyo-a , 여화선 Yeo Hwa-sun
Abstract
As the nation-wide interest in walking path has increased, the central and local governments are creating or designating `walkable paths`. Although Seoul castle is historically and aesthetically significant, paths inside the castle are deteriorated by increasing number of visitors. For this reason, this study aims to draw factors which can be reflected in future maintenance strategy by analyzing significance and satisfaction of paths at Bukak Mountain, among other Seoul castle paths. Based on such results, we intend to figure out differences between factors what visitors think significant and factors what they think satisfactory. In addition this will be suggested as a fundamental data in order to establish differentiated maintenance strategy that would promote inter-relation. This study consists of research and analysis including publication, current situation, survey, statistic and data analysis. As a result, 17 categories showed meaningful difference between significance and satisfaction, implying the necessity of corresponding maintenance strategy. Especially, signpost and path were high in significance but low in satisfaction, suggesting necessary maintenance. In order to set a maintenance strategy in human-restricted area, significance and satisfaction analysis is extremely strategic and provide useful information. Therefore, this study can be utilized as a fundamental data that helps to build related policies with maintenance priorities.
